The Meadows might be a bit far from Addo (we would prefer something closer so that we can go through the park on the Sunday).

Slagboom is indeed closed, both for accommodation and the trail - pity, looked like it would have been ideal.

There is a grade 4 route within the park itself, but could be on the pricey side with costs; R455 per vehicle and daily entrance fee of R54 per adult.
